ansible.builtin.host_list inventory – 解析“主机列表”字符串

注意

此清单插件是 ansible-core 的一部分,包含在所有 Ansible 安装中。在大多数情况下,您可以使用简短的插件名称 host_list。但是,我们建议您使用 完全限定集合名称 (FQCN) ansible.builtin.host_list,以便轻松链接到插件文档并避免与可能具有相同清单插件名称的其他集合发生冲突。

摘要

  • 将主机列表字符串解析为以逗号分隔的主机值

  • 此插件仅适用于不是路径且包含逗号的清单字符串。

示例

# define 2 hosts in command line
# ansible -i '10.10.2.6, 10.10.2.4' -m ping all

# DNS resolvable names
# ansible -i 'host1.example.com, host2' -m user -a 'name=me state=absent' all

# just use localhost
# ansible-playbook -i 'localhost,' play.yml -c local

提示

每个条目类型的配置条目具有从低到高的优先级顺序。例如,列表中较低的变量将覆盖较高的变量。